Do you know what the easiest way to spoil someone’s mood is? Just waste their time. Keep them waiting at a restaurant or show them a third rated movie or make them listen to a needlessly long, beaten around the bush talk. If you are not careful, the third example can be you and you would be spoiling a whole lot of people’s mood. That is why in Toastmasters, we help you time your speeches and as the timer today, I will alert you about your time limits.
For the prepared speeches, the time limit is 5 to 7 minutes. At the end of 5 minutes, I will flash the green card, followed by yellow at 6 and red at the end of 7 minutes.
For the Table Topic Session, the time limit is 1 to 2 minutes. At the end of 1 minute, I will flash the green card, followed by yellow at 1.5 and red at the end of 2 minutes.
For the Speech Evaluations, the time limit is 2 to 3 minutes. At the end of 2 minutes, I will flash the green card, followed by yellow at 2.5 and red at the end of 3 minutes.
There is a grace time of 30 seconds after the red card is flashed each time to wrap up your speeches.
I will come back with my report towards the end of the meeting.
